Guide
on De Minimis Rules for Bus Subsidy Contracts
These notes, authored by DfT, provide guidance on the changes introduced
by the Service Subsidy Agreements (Tendering) (England) (Amendment) Regulations
2004 which came into force on 1 April 2004.
The provisions in these regulations
are commonly referred to as the 'De Minimis' rules/exceptions, under which
local transport authorities are in some cases excepted from the requirement
to let bus subsidy contracts through competitive tender.
This is particularly relevant to CT operators wishing to bid for contracts with local transport authorities, as it gives these authorities powers to let certain contracts without having to use a competitive tendering process.
